Introduction: Deconstructing the Fraction
The expression 20/44000 represents a fraction. In practice, the top number, 20, is the numerator, representing the part we are interested in. In real terms, the bottom number, 44000, is the denominator, representing the total or the whole. A fraction signifies a part of a whole. Because of this, 20/44000 means 20 parts out of a total of 44000 parts.
Our goal is to simplify this fraction and express it in different forms to better understand its magnitude. We will explore several methods to achieve this, making the process clear and understandable for everyone, regardless of their mathematical background.
Method 1: Simplifying the Fraction Through Division
The simplest approach involves finding the greatest common divisor (GCD) of both the numerator and denominator and dividing both by it. The GCD is the largest number that divides both 20 and 44000 without leaving a remainder.
In this case, the GCD of 20 and 44000 is 20. Dividing both the numerator and the denominator by 20, we get:
20 ÷ 20 = 1 44000 ÷ 20 = 2200
So, 20/44000 simplifies to 1/2200. This simplified fraction is much easier to work with and provides a clearer representation of the proportion.
Method 2: Converting the Fraction to a Decimal
Converting the fraction to a decimal provides a different perspective. To do this, we simply divide the numerator by the denominator:
1 ÷ 2200 ≈ 0.0004545
This decimal representation, approximately 0.0004545, shows that 20 out of 44000 represents a very small proportion.
Method 3: Expressing the Fraction as a Percentage
Percentages are particularly useful for expressing proportions relative to 100. To convert the fraction to a percentage, we multiply the decimal equivalent by 100:
0.0004545 × 100 ≈ 0.04545%
So in practice, 20 out of 44000 represents approximately 0.Which means 04545%. Again, this emphasizes the small magnitude of the proportion.
Method 4: Understanding Ratios
The fraction 20/44000 can also be expressed as a ratio. This indicates that for every 1 part, there are 2200 parts in the whole. In this case, the ratio is 20:44000, which simplifies to 1:2200. Practically speaking, a ratio shows the relative size of two or more values. Ratios are frequently used in various contexts, such as comparing quantities, scaling recipes, or expressing proportions in scientific experiments.
